What is the deadline to request the adoption of a child in Honduras?

In Honduras, there is no specific deadline to request the adoption of a child. The application can be submitted at any time as long as the established legal requirements are met.

What is the role of stock exchanges in promoting the stock market in Guatemala?

Stock exchanges play an important role in promoting the stock market in Guatemala. These institutions facilitate the buying and selling of securities, such as stocks and bonds, between investors and issuers. Stock exchanges provide a regulated and transparent environment where investors can participate in the capital market. In addition, stock exchanges promote transparency and disclosure of financial information, which provides confidence to investors and facilitates the formation of fair prices. This promotes the channeling of savings towards productive investment, encourages access to financing for companies and contributes to the growth of the stock market in Guatemala.

What is the situation of access to justice for people affected by gender discrimination in Honduras?

The situation of access to justice for people affected by gender discrimination in Honduras faces challenges due to the lack of effective response from the authorities, impunity and re-victimization in the judicial system. Many women and girls face obstacles in reporting discrimination and obtaining legal protection and support in cases of gender violence and discrimination in the workplace and in society.

What measures should a financial entity in Colombia take to comply with AML?

Financial institutions must implement anti-money laundering programs, conduct due diligence, report suspicious transactions to the UIAF, and provide ongoing training to their staff.

Are financial institutions required to maintain transaction records under KYC?

Yes, financial institutions in Paraguay are required to maintain transaction records for a certain period, which facilitates supervision and audit by regulatory authorities and SEPRELAD.
